Posting cadence

At 4.4 posts per week, @adidas publishes on a rhythm you can plan against rather than a single campaign burst. The oldest analyzed post is dated May 7, 2026 and the newest June 7, 2026. The format mix in this window is 18 carousels, 2 videos. Friday is the busiest day in the sample, carrying 5 of the 20 posts.

Cadence is the cheapest competitive signal to act on. It tells you the publishing volume you would need to match this sportswear brand in a visitor's feed, and whether the account leans on one format or spreads across several.

Is this an official Adidas analytics report?

No. InstaSeer is independent and not affiliated with Adidas or Instagram. Every number here is derived from Adidas's public posts, and each row links to the original post so you can check it yourself. Private metrics such as reach, impressions, saves, and ad spend are not public and do not appear anywhere in this report.
